[Bug 639768] [NEW] Samba process gets hung on maverick update

johny 639768 at bugs.launchpad.net
Wed Sep 15 18:22:06 BST 2010


Public bug reported:

Binary package hint: samba

On the last maverick update at the moment of configuring samba, the update-manager freezes.
The progress bar  stops going forward and the terminal output gets stuck on the "Setting up samba" step. (please see the screenshot)
